Improvement of PageRank Algorithm: An authoritative and temporal based approach

Shuhua Chen, Han Yan, Jiancheng Li, Junjie Wang, Yuting Mao, Jun Liu

Open publisher page 2 citations

Abstract

PageRank Algorithm, based on the link analysis, has been widely used to measure the popularity of the web pages. However, in the classical algorithm, the transition probability of the certain page is distributed equally by the page's out-links, which does not meet the real actions on WWW. This paper investigates the authoritative factor (based on the link analysis) and the temporal factor in accessing the importance of web pages. It is believed that web pages with large in-links or out-links (we call them authoritative ones) and newly pages are more attractive towards the visitors. Hence, the extended algorithm, Weighted Authoritative and Temporal Ranking Algorithm (WAT-Ranking), takes these aspects into account via re-distributing the transition probabilities. Simulation experimental results show that the proposed strategy can improve the quality of the page ranking.
